Who is Alison Morrow?

Alison Morrow began her journalism career as a producer at FOX News Channel in New York City. She left news to complete a Master of Divinity degree at Boston University, specializing in Psychology & Counseling. Her return to news as a reporter took her to newsrooms in Georgia, Tennessee, Florida and Washington state. Alison most recently served as Environmental Reporter for KING TV, the NBC affiliate in Seattle. She is the recipient of two Emmy Awards, an Associated Press Award and the prestigious Sigma Delta Chi Award for Excellence in Journalism from the Society of Professional Journalists. She has worked with a wide range of clients from research biologists to non-profits to farmers and has conducted multiple media training workshops, both locally and internationally. Alison hosts a popular podcast detailing the plight of the endangered Southern Resident killer whales as well as a YouTube channel focused on media analysis and free speech issues. She is the wife of a USMC veteran, and the mom of a rescue pit bull and two horses.
